2006 Sedona Red Rock High graduate Joseph Strong has recently committed to play baseball for Coach Chris Brown and the San Diego City College Knights.

Strong will start at catcher beginning next spring for the Knights.

“I feel really good about my opportunity to play baseball for the Knights,” Strong said.

“I love San Diego, and I look forward to a new place,” he added.

Strong played baseball for the Scorpions from 2002 to 2006 and went to Arizona State University to attend school.

He stayed in baseball shape by playing club baseball for the Northern Arizona All-Stars team for two seasons.

The NAAS season runs only during the summer, but he was noticed by a scout for SDCC.

“I enjoyed my time with the all-stars team, but this is what I really want to do, and that is play baseball in college,” Strong said.

Strong, 19, was then recruited by Brown, who is in his 17th year of coaching at the community college level and his seventh at SDCC.

Brown has also been involved with the United States baseball team for several years.

“Coach Brown has been involved with baseball for many years, and I look forward to playing for him,” Strong said.

Brown was unavailable for comment.

The dream is still alive in Strong, as he is committing to play baseball for a solid junior college baseball program.

“I want to move on to the next level, a Division I school or even the minor leagues. This is the next step for me,” Strong said.

Strong will also be looking forward to just a change of scenery.

“I grew up in Sedona, and I’ve been in Arizona my entire life. San Diego brings a new challenge and a new environment,” Strong said.

“I’m very excited,” he added.
